4-12)   One piece of lumber was cut to 4 feet long pieces. 5 cuts were made. How long was the lumber before it was cut?

                             

     

 

 

4-13)  Add +, - , x and/or ( ) signs in the spaces to the left side of the "=" sign to make the equations work.

      a)   1   1   3   8 = 24

      b)   6   5   4   6 = 24

 

 

4-14)  Find the sequence and fill in the blanks

   a)   3, 4, 6, 9, 13, __, 24

   b)   1, 2, 5, 10, __, 26, __

   c)   6, 8, 12, 18, __, 36

   d)   45, 30, 18, 9, __, 0
